>> Yes I was missing something :). If the content type is null for a GET
>> request, it is default to application/x-www-form-urlencoded in  the
>> org.apache.axis2.transport.http.util.RESTUtil.java.
>>
>> if (contentType == null || "".equals(contentType)) {
>>    contentType = HTTPConstants.MEDIA_TYPE_X_WWW_FORM;
>> }
>
> Well that may work but its wrong :-). GET (or any HTTP request that has no
> entity body) is not required to have a content type and does not have a
> content type.
> So we should fix it properly by having the default builder notion .. not a
> default content type concept.
